Hello, Does anybody know about or have a Walter Watson in their Family tree? He was born c1848- 1854 and is said to be the husband of Annie Louisa Standen. Annie was living in Sunbury Middlesex in 1881. The census shows she had 3 young children. One of these being my Grandfather George Watson born mar 1879. She was wife and head of the family at this census. Walter was not on the census. The 1891 shows Annie still on the Sunbury census with the children plus a daughter born after the 1881 census aged 8. Annie is on the1891 census as wife but Walter is again missing. Has anyone any information at all. Many thanks Margaret
